For many years I had a Asko front loader and it was fabulous. Miele would be similar I guess. When it finally gave up after more than 15 years of constant use, I bought a Bosch. It is good, but I wish I had bought another Asko, as it was easier to work out how to do different loads (probably because I was used to it) and there was no rubber seal which I now have. I prefer the door without the bulky rubber seal.
You will find that with an expensive European front loader, repairs bills are not expensive, because they don't break down
. The few times I had trouble with my machine it was because coins or nails were in the lint trap which stopped the water being pumped out efficiently and I soon learnt to check it regularly.
